# Onboarding: the flaky DNS thing

Welcome to on-call! You'll eventually hit the Nimblet resolver flake: lookups for internal services randomly time out for ~30 seconds, then recover. It's a known cache-stampede bug, fix in progress. Usual move is to restart the resolver pod and watch the dashboard settle. If the admin panel itself won't resolve, use the emergency console — to unlock it, enter the recovery passphrase below.

unlock words, yawig-kagef: gordor-holvan-ulaael-pramir-ulaiel-tamdor

## TilePorter — Environment Variables

TilePorter prefetches map tiles for the Cartovia render farm. Config lives in `/etc/tileporter/env`.

- `TP_REGION_SET` — comma-separated region slugs.
- `TP_CONCURRENCY` — worker count; keep under 16.
- `TP_CACHE_DIR` — must be on the NVMe volume.

Do not hardcode credentials in unit files. The upstream tile broker requires a signed token on every fetch. Add the following line to the env file:

env line for fafof-fahag: LEDGER_TOKEN5=f8790

### Assignment API

The Bramblewick Assignment Service returns deterministic variant assignments for A/B experiments. Plugin authors should call the assignment endpoint once per subject and cache the result locally, because repeated calls within an experiment epoch always return the same bucket. Responses include the experiment key, variant label, and epoch timestamp. Malformed subject identifiers produce a 422 with a diagnostic body. Every request must carry the bearer token that follows below.

session JWT of yawep-yawep = eyJhbGciOiJIUzI1NiIsInR5cCI6IkpXVCJ9.eyJzdWIiOiI3pWF3_In0.aXYsHiog

Handover for weekly sync: the tax-rate lookup cache in Ledgerpine was invalidating hourly instead of daily, hammering the upstream rates service. I bumped the TTL and added a stale-while-revalidate path. Tomas owns this next sprint. One open item: regional overrides still bypass the cache entirely. The full cache design doc and open questions are here.

operations page: https://jenkins.zemvarcloud.local/job/merge_requests/repo/build/73930b4b30f0a8ed